Solving Linear Inequalities On A Number Line

Q1 » » Solve and Show solution on Number Line 7x +3 < 5x +9 Solve and Show solution on Number Line 7x +3 < 5x +9

Sol » » » » 7x – 5x < 9 – 3 » 2x < 6 » x < 37x – 5x < 9 – 3 » 2x < 6 » x < 3

Sol. » Sol. » Steps to solving and graphing the InequalitySteps to solving and graphing the Inequality

Step 1 :- Assume that X + Y = 5 and find the following values

Step 2 :- Plot these points on graph

Step 3 :- Choose the half by taking some value for X or Y. if it satisfies the

inequality then shade that region as the Answer and if doesn’t then the other graph is the solution
